Purpose:
This new Community Right (sometimes called the
“Community Right to Buy” or “Community Right to
Bid”) allows defined community groups, including Parish
Councils, to ask the Council to list certain assets as being of
“community value”. This is designed to give communities
more opportunities to take control of the assets and facilities
important to them.

Decision:
The nomination of Mole Music Venue in Bath was
not successful.
Unfortunately, because the application we received for Moles to be
made an asset of community value didn’t meet the criteria
(which are set out in national legislation), it wasn’t
successful.
However, we have informed the nominating body that we remain open
to receive a new application.
